First, let’s define what 2×2 twill and plain weave are. 2×2 twill is a type of weave where the weft yarns pass over two warp yarns and then under two warp yarns, creating a diagonal pattern. On the other hand, plain weave is a simple over-and-under pattern where the weft yarns alternate over and under each warp yarn.
